
New ACR Stealer campaigns use WebDAV, MSHTA to evade detection
Microsoft has issued a warning about a recent surge in ACR Stealer activity that uses ClickFix-style social engineering to steal credentials, browser data, and sensitive business documents.
In a new report, Microsoft researchers detailed two separate campaigns observed between late April and mid-June 2026 that use different execution techniques for the same theft.
The campaign was seen tricking users into executing malicious commands to resolve a fake issue.
